    721110 - Hotels (except Casino Hotels) and Motels

    If you're exploring the hospitality industry or government contracting opportunities related to lodging, understanding NAICS code 721110 is essential. This code covers a broad range of hotels and motels that offer short-term accommodations—excluding casino hotels—and is a cornerstone classification within the Accommodation and Food Services sector.

    What is NAICS Code 721110?

    NAICS 721110 designates establishments primarily engaged in providing short-term lodging services through facilities such as hotels, motor hotels, or motels. These businesses often supplement their lodging offerings with additional amenities like food and beverage services, recreational facilities, and conference rooms designed to meet guests' diverse needs.

    Sector Overview: Accommodation and Food Services

    NAICS 721110 falls under the larger Accommodation and Food Services sector, which encompasses businesses providing lodging and meals for immediate consumption. Within this sector, this specific code focuses on lodging without the gaming or casino component, differentiating it from casino hotels.

    Typical Business Activities

    Businesses classified under NAICS 721110 include, but are not limited to:

    • Business Hotels
    • Resort Hotels (excluding casinos)
    • Motels
    • Motor Inns and Motor Lodges
    • Seasonal Hotels

    These establishments typically offer:

    • Short-term guest rooms or suites
    • Onsite dining and bar services
    • Recreational amenities like golf courses, tennis courts, or health spas
    • Conference and meeting room facilities

    Size Standard for NAICS 721110

    For government contracting and small business classification purposes, the size standard for NAICS code 721110 is set at $40 million in average annual receipts. This means businesses with gross revenues at or under this threshold may qualify as small businesses under this classification, unlocking potential contracting advantages.

    Examples of Businesses Under NAICS 721110

    • Business Hotels: Catering predominantly to business travelers with amenities like meeting rooms and high-speed internet.
    • Resort Hotels: Offering luxury accommodations alongside recreational activities such as golf, skiing, or spa services.
    • Motels: Typically located near highways, providing convenient short-term stays for travelers.

    Detailed NAICS Code 721110 Breakdown

    Code Description Explanation
    Alpine skiing facilities with accommodations (i.e., ski resorts) Ski resorts providing both lodging and recreational skiing activities
    Auto courts, lodging Roadside lodging facilities designed for motorists
    Automobile courts, lodging Another term for motels or motor courts
    Health spas (i.e., physical fitness facilities) with accommodations Facilities combining lodging with wellness and fitness amenities
    Hotel management services (i.e., providing management and operating staff to run hotel) Firms specializing in running hotel operations on behalf of owners
    Hotels (except casino hotels) Traditional hotels excluding those with casino operations
    Hotels (except casino hotels) with golf courses, tennis courts, and/or other health spa facilities Resort-style hotels that emphasize wellness and recreation alongside accommodations
    Hotels, membership Hotels offering membership or loyalty programs
    Hotels, resort, without casinos Destination hotels focusing on leisure without casino gaming
    Hotels, seasonal, without casinos Hotels operating primarily in peak seasons excluding casino features
    Membership hotels Hotels with subscription or membership-based access
    Motels Motor lodging facilities convenient for short stays
    Motor courts Drive-up lodging accommodations for travelers
    Motor hotels without casinos Hotels designed primarily for motorists excluding gaming options
    Motor inns Smaller-scale motor hotels
    Motor lodges Lodging catering mainly to motorists
    Resort hotels without casinos Full-service leisure hotels without casino facilities
    Seasonal hotels without casinos Hotels that operate seasonally excluding casinos
    Ski lodges and resorts with accommodations Lodging catered specifically for ski vacationers
    Summer resort hotels without casinos Leisure hotels operating seasonally during summer, no casinos
    Tourist lodges Rustic or remote hotels catering to tourists

    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

    Q: What types of hotels are excluded from NAICS code 721110?
    A: This code excludes casino hotels—establishments primarily engaged in casino gaming alongside lodging.

    Q: Can a ski resort fall under NAICS 721110?
    A: Yes. Ski resorts with lodging accommodations are included under this NAICS code.

    Q: What is the significance of the $40 million size standard?
    A: The $40 million threshold determines if a company qualifies as a small business for federal contracting purposes under NAICS 721110.

    Q: Does this code cover hotel management companies?
    A: Yes. Hotel management services that provide operating staff and management to hotels without casinos fall under this category.

    Q: Are motels included in NAICS 721110?
    A: Yes, motels, motor inns, and motor lodges are all covered under this NAICS code.
